Board hears readings of building-code, property-maintenance and mobile-food-truck ordinances
The Board of Mayor and Aldermen reviewed two ordinance readings during its Feb. 26 workshop.

On second reading, Ordinance 2026-3 would amend Titles 7 and 12 of the Lever Municipal Code to adopt the 2024 editions of multiple International Codes — including the 2024 International Fire Code, Building Code, Plumbing Code, Fuel Gas Code, Energy Conservation Code, Mechanical Code, Residential Code, Property Maintenance Code, and Existing Building Code — and amend Title 13 regarding property-maintenance regulations. The Chair presented the ordinance and asked for questions; none were raised during the workshop.

The board also took up second reading of Ordinance 2026-04 to amend the city’s rules for mobile food trucks (Title 9, Chapter 9). The Chair noted the item had been discussed at an earlier meeting and invited comments; no substantive questions or amendments were recorded in the workshop transcript.

Both ordinances remained at their respective reading stages in the meeting record; the workshop transcript does not show final adoption votes for these ordinances.
